Consider the investor profile – whether on LinkedIn, a dedicated real estate platform, or even a personal website. Is it structured to convey authority, experience, and a clear investment thesis? A generic profile stating 'real estate investor' won't cut it. Instead, savvy investors are meticulously crafting their digital personas to reflect their specific niche, track record, and acquisition criteria.

"We've seen a direct correlation between a highly optimized LinkedIn profile and an increase in off-market deal inquiries," notes Marcus Thorne, a seasoned investor who has executed over 250 flips. "It's not about vanity; it's about signaling to brokers, wholesalers, and even distressed homeowners that you're a serious, capable buyer who can close quickly."

This means clearly articulating your preferred asset classes (e.g., 'multi-family value-add, 50-100 units, Class B/C'), geographic focus, and typical deal size. Include concrete examples of past successes – perhaps a 15% ROI on a recent foreclosure flip or a 10-cap acquisition that's now cash-flowing. Use keywords that potential partners or sellers might search for, such as 'pre-foreclosure solutions,' 'short sale expert,' or 'distressed property acquisition.'

Beyond just attracting deals, a robust online profile also builds credibility for financing. Lenders and private money partners often conduct due diligence on an investor's professional background. A well-maintained, authoritative presence signals reliability and experience, potentially easing loan approvals or attracting better terms.
